The Science of Peace Education
Presented live on UN World Science Day, GPEN and the World Academy of Art and Science brought together more than 30 contributors to share tools for trust, transformation and tomorrow.
UN World Science Day
Peacebuilding skills are urgently needed.
Around the planet, climate upheaval, armed conflict, historic waves of human displacement, and other crises threaten our existence. Communities must master the peace practices required to build trust, transform conflict, and create a viable future.
